About Cycles MCP Server

MCP budget and risk authority for AI Agents — runtime governance for Claude, Cursor, and Windsurf

Config

Add this server to your MCP-compatible client using the configuration below.

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"cycles-mcp-server": {
      "command": "npx",
      "args": [
        "@runcycles/mcp-server"
      ]
    }
  }
}
